Netbeans: возможность изменить поведение генерации getter / setter в модуле php - PullRequest
1 голос
/ 02 апреля 2012

Привет программистам,

Мне было интересно, есть ли возможность изменить поведение генерации getter / setter в модуле php. На данный момент это работает так:

class A
{
    private $field;
}

Теперь я сгенерирую setter, нажав alt + ins и выбрав «Setter ...», что приведет к:

class A
{
    private $field;

    public function setField($field)
    {
         $this->field = $field;
    }
}

Есть ли возможность изменить поведение, чтобы оно генерировало что-то другое, скажем так:

class A
{
    private $field;

    public function setField($field)
    {
         $this->field = $field;
         return $this;
    }
}

Разница в returh $ этой строке.

1 Ответ

1 голос
/ 17 октября 2012

Я столкнулся с этим старым вопросом, когда искал способы настройки шаблона, используемого для генерации сеттера / геттера в netbeans.

Поскольку этот вопрос оставлен без ответа, я оставлю указатель на похожий вопрос: Как редактировать шаблоны получения и установки в NetBeans?

В основном ответ таков: нет, вы не можете изменить шаблон генератора сеттера / геттера в netbeans. По крайней мере, если вы не хотите исправлять исходный код Netbeans.

...